Sure Group Engineer Wins West Midlands Regional Training Award for Building Services Engineering 2009.
Martin Butler, a Sure Group Engineer based in the West
Midlands has won an award in the H&V Domestic
Heating Category in the West Midlands Regional Training
Awards 2009.
Martin was nominated for the award by his college tutor
Mr Chris Astbury of Dudley College. Martin will attend a
glittering award ceremony later in the year, where he will
be presented with a voucher, glass trophy and certificate.
Sure Group and Dudley College will also be presented
with a certificate for their support in his training. Martin
is currently working towards Level 3 technical certificate
and NVQ. Martin will now be put forward for the
National Training Awards organised by Summitskills.

Dave Fleetwood is celebrating after successfully completing his engineering apprenticeship.
Dave was working in the Liverpool Sure Group Office and dealing with the engineers on a day-to-day basis. He knew that being an engineer could be the right career move for him, so Dave approached his manager and asked for the chance to become an engineer.
So in September 2007, Dave took the first steps on his new career ladder and set off to Liverpool
Community College, Vauxhall Road, where he had enrolled on NVQ Level 2 6012-02 in Domestic Natural
Gas Installation and Maintenance. After 2 years of hard work and commitment, Dave completed his apprenticeship on 9th September 09. He is now working as fully fledged engineer on the Riverside Housing Contract (formerly Riverside Liverpool). He has never looked back!
